Planning To Buy The Hyundai Creta? You Can Save Up To Rs 1 Lakh In June 2026

Hyundai is offering lucrative benefits of up to Rs 1 lakh on almost its entire product portfolio, save for the facelifted Ioniq 5, valid till the end of June 2026. These include cash discounts, exchange benefits & scrappage offers, along with corporate benefits for eligible government and corporate employees. Here are the details: –

Disclaimer: The above-mentioned discounts may vary depending on the chosen variant, location, and stock availability. Check with your local dealership for exact figures.

Hyundai’s best-selling offering, the Creta, is available with the highest discounts this month, followed by the pre-facelift stocks of the Verna. On the contrary, the Hyundai Venue sub-4m SUV gets the least discount this month.
